Understanding the Core Rules of Teen Patti Gold

At its heart, teen patti gold is a game of three-card poker. Each player aims to have the best hand or to make other players fold through strategic betting. The game starts with each participant placing an initial ‘boot’ or ante into the pot. Players are then dealt three cards face down, and the betting rounds begin. Players can choose to play ‘seen’ (view their cards) or ‘blind’ (play without looking). This creates an early element of calculated risk. The game flows with subsequent rounds of betting, raising, and calling, until only one player remains with the winning hand or all other players have folded.

The hand rankings, while similar to poker, have a few distinctions that are vital to remember. A ‘trail’ (three of a kind) is highest, followed by a ‘pure sequence’ (three consecutive cards of the same suit), a ‘sequence’ (three consecutive cards of different suits), a ‘flush’ (three cards of the same suit), a ‘pair’ (two cards of the same rank), and finally, a ‘high card.’ Knowing these rankings and practicing hand evaluation is foundational for consistent success.

The Importance of Bankroll Management

Effective bankroll management is paramount when playing teen patti gold, just as it is in any form of gambling. It is a critical skill that often determines success or failure. Players should set a budget for their gameplay and adhere to it strictly, avoiding the temptation to chase losses or bet beyond their means. Recognizing the risks of playing, and then setting limits on losses before they occur, will help a player avoid chasing losses, which could quickly lead to funds depleting. A robust bankroll provides a cushion against losing streaks, allowing players to weather periods of bad luck and continue playing strategically.

Consider the amount you are willing to risk, and never exceed that limit. A common guideline is to risk only a small percentage of your bankroll on each hand, typically between 1% and 5%. This conservative approach helps preserve your capital and extends your playtime. Implement a stop-loss strategy, where you cease playing once you have reached a predetermined loss threshold. This requires discipline but can prevent catastrophic losses. Similarly, set a win goal—a target amount that, once achieved, prompts you to cash out and solidify your profits.

Lastly, recognising your emotional state and playing sober can dramatically improve your ability to use sound judgement. Playing while stressed or upset can lead to impulsive decisions and poor betting choices.

Reading Opponents: The Art of Bluffing and Calling

Teen patti gold is not solely about the cards you hold; it’s also a game of psychology. Reading your opponents—deciphering their betting patterns, body language (in live games), and general playing style—is essential. Observing how players react to different situations can reveal whether they have a strong hand or are bluffing. Experienced players will often vary their betting patterns to avoid being easily read. Look for tells: subtle behavioral cues that might indicate the strength or weakness of their hand.

Mastering the art of bluffing is another crucial skill. A well-timed bluff can convince opponents with weaker hands to fold, allowing you to win the pot even without having a strong hand yourself. However, bluffing should be used sparingly and strategically. Frequent or predictable bluffing will quickly be detected by astute opponents. Conversely, knowing when to call an opponent’s bluff is equally important. Consider the betting history, the opponent’s reputation, and the potential risk-reward ratio before making the call.

Successful play demands a balance between bluffing, calling, and playing strong hands. The ability to adapt your strategy to the specific players at the table and the evolving game dynamics is essential for long-term success.

Understanding Hand Rankings: A Comprehensive Guide

A firm grasp of the hand rankings is absolutely fundamental to mastering teen patti gold. Knowing which hands are powerful and which are weak will guide your betting decisions and help you make informed calls. The highest-ranking hand is a ‘trail,’ also known as three of a kind, where all three cards have the same rank. For instance, three Kings is a trail and nearly unbeatable. Secondly is a ‘pure sequence’ which consists of three consecutive cards, all of the same suit, for example 5, 6, 7 of hearts.

Following the pure sequence is a ‘sequence,’ which comprises three consecutive cards of different suits—like 5 of hearts, 6 of spades, and 7 of clubs. A ‘flush’ consists of three cards of the same suit, but not in sequence, like 2, 8, and Jack of diamonds. After the flush comes a ‘pair’, with two matching cards with an additional single card and then, finally, a ‘high card’ hand, which simply has no matching sequences, suits, or pairs but depends on the numerical value of the highest card in the hand.

Advanced Strategies for the Discerning Teen Patti Gold Player

Once you have mastered the basic rules and strategies, you can explore more advanced techniques to elevate your game. These include understanding pot odds and implied odds, using position to your advantage, and implementing calculated betting patterns. Pot odds refer to the ratio between the cost of a call and the potential reward. Implied odds consider the potential for future winnings on subsequent betting rounds. These calculations can help you determine whether a call is mathematically profitable.

Position, or where you sit relative to the dealer button, plays a critical role. Playing in late position allows you to observe the actions of your opponents before making your own decision, giving you more information to work with. Different betting patterns can convey different signals. Aggressive betting can intimidate opponents, while a more conservative approach can induce them to bluff. Adapt your betting style to the specific game situation and the tendencies of your opponents.
